To understand the financial landscape, we must separate the base purchase price from the total cost of ownership (TCO). A standard Concrete Pipe Mold is manufactured in high volumes, using generalized designs that fit average production lines. Custom molds, on the other hand, are built to your exact pipe diameter, wall thickness, joint configuration, and machine interface.
| Cost Factor | Standard Off-the-Shelf Concrete Pipe Mold | Custom Concrete Pipe Mold (by Water Conservancy Machinery) |
|---|---|---|
| Initial Purchase Price | $8,000 – $25,000 (depending on size) | $25,000 – $70,000+ (engineering + tooling included) |
| Lead Time | 2–4 weeks (ready stock) | 6–10 weeks (designed + fabricated) |
| Modification Flexibility | None (fixed dimensions) | Full (variable diameters, O-rings, bell/spigot ends) |
| Production Output per Shift | 12–15 pipes (general fit) | 22–28 pipes (optimized for your vibration/compaction system) |
| Maintenance Cost (Annual) | $3,000 – $5,000 (higher wear due to fit issues) | $1,500 – $2,500 (precision alignment reduces fatigue) |
The lower entry cost of a standard Concrete Pipe Mold often masks three critical inefficiencies:
Waste Material: A generalized mold cavity does not account for your specific concrete slump or aggregate size, leading to 4–7% more rejected pipes per batch.
Downtime: Standard molds frequently require shims and adapters to fit your pallet or centrifugal casting machine, adding 20–30 minutes per setup change.
Shorter Service Life: Mass-produced molds use thinner steel plates (6–8 mm) to keep costs low, whereas Water Conservancy Machinery fabricates custom units with 12 mm abrasion-resistant steel, often outlasting standard options by 3:1 in cycle count.
A custom Concrete Pipe Mold eliminates these drags. For a medium-scale plant producing 500 pipes per week, the custom solution typically pays back its premium within 8–12 months purely through reduced scrap and higher uptime.

Q3: Can a standard Concrete Pipe Mold be retrofitted later to become a custom-like solution, saving money?
A: Retrofitting a standard Concrete Pipe Mold is rarely cost-effective. The base steel is typically too thin for welding new joint rings, and the alignment pins are not designed for re-machining. Most retrofit attempts cost 50–60% of a new custom price but deliver only 30% of the performance gain. Water Conservancy Machinery advises against this path. What truly distinguishes a custom Concrete Pipe Mold from a shelf item is the pre-sale engineering audit. Water Conservancy Machinery does not simply take your diameter and wall thickness; we analyze your concrete mix design, curing method, and demolding cycle. This data allows us to adjust the taper angle (usually 1.5° to 3°) and surface finish (Ra 0.8–1.2 µm) so that every pipe ejects smoothly without vacuum lock. This level of optimization is simply unavailable with standard products.
